Output 8118ca47fc1854396376ba243e621cb3136478ab85cb4c826937d8762f7d77ec:52
- value
- 64508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bfd923aefd8fd165442309f660a1dacc6a7fee3 OP_EQUAL
- address
- 3MkDfzSw3brXP8cyF9BKqJmhFscjSTcvEw
- transaction
- 8118ca47fc1854396376ba243e621cb3136478ab85cb4c826937d8762f7d77ec
- confirmations
- 196154
- spent
- true